Z690M PG Riptide/D5 BIOS Feature Hardware Monitor OS Certifications • 1 x USB 2.0 Header (Supports 2 USB 2.0 ports) (Supports ESD Protection) • 1 x USB 3.2 Gen1 Header (Supports 2 USB 3.2 Gen1 ports) (Supports ESD Protection) • 1 x Front Panel Type C USB 3.2 Gen1 Header (Supports ESD Protection) • AMI UEFI Legal BIOS with multilingual GUI support • ACPI 6.0 Compliant wake up events • SMBIOS 2.7 Support • CPU Core/Cache, CPU GT, VDD2, DRAM, VCCIN AUX, +1.8V PROC, +1.05V PROC, +0.82V PCH , +1.05V PCH Voltage Multi-adjustment • Fan Tachometer: CPU, CPU/Water Pump, Chassis/Water Pump Fans • Quiet Fan (Auto adjust chassis fan speed by CPU temperature): CPU, CPU/Water Pump, Chassis/Water Pump Fans • Fan Multi-Speed Control: CPU, CPU/Water Pump, Chassis/ Water Pump Fans • Voltage monitoring: CPU Vcore, VCCSA, VDD2, +1.05V PROC, +0.82V PCH, ATX+5VSB, VCCIN AUX, PCH, +12V, +5V, +3.3V • Microsoft® Windows® 10 64-bit / 11 64-bit • FCC, CE • ErP/EuP ready (ErP/EuP ready power supply is required) * For detailed product information, please visit our website: http://www.asrock.com Please realize that there is a certain risk involved with overclocking, including adjusting the setting in the BIOS, applying Untied Overclocking Technology, or using third-party overclocking tools. Overclocking may affect your system's stability, or even cause damage to the components and devices of your system. It should be done at your own risk and expense. We are not responsible for possible damage caused by overclocking. 5 English
